Как в Windows подключить сетевой диск по SSH

Author Автор: Роман Чернышов    Опубликовано: 5 ноября 2023

Добрый день, друзья! Хочу поделиться небольшой заметкой. Имея удаленный сервер с доступом по SSH, одним из удобных способов работы с его файловой системой, из Windows, может быть — подключение(монтирование) ее отдельным сетевом диском с назначением собственной буквы. Для этого в Windows потребуется установить WinFSP и SSHFS-Win, а также создать .bat файл для автоматического монтирования сетевого диска после перезагрузки. Об этом данная заметка. подробнее

Инвестиции в самое дно рынка недвижимости, посчитаем?

Author Автор: Роман Чернышов    Опубликовано: 16 октября 2023

realtyК вопросу об инвестициях. В любую эпоху, с тем или иным успехом, бизнес продолжает приносить доход — кто-бы что не говорил! И когда счета и налоги уплачены(уплОчены), возникает вопрос о том, куда бы эти денюжки(прибыль, сбережения, «накопыш») вложить? Вопреки всеобщему мнению, что мол: — «Были бы деньги, а куда вложить, мы придумаем», реальность порой куда гораздо сложнее. Предложений инвестировать кровно-заработанные много, и все как на подбор обещают золотые горы, через год, месяц, неделю или даже день — всё отбить, но есть одно «но», все они какие-то, мягко говоря — сомнительные… Напротив, другие же, традиционные инструменты инвестирования, сулят слишком маленький процент, с трудом покрывающий инфляцию. Скучно. Про инвестиции в собственный же бизнес(у всех же есть собственный бизнес?), я говорить не буду, предполагая, что на данном этапе потребность его в инвестициях — закрыта. Да и хочется нам, так, чтобы: — и надежно, и прибыльно, и желательно пассивно. Верно? Конечно! (ответите вы). Ну тогда, снова, она «самая», наша «родненькая» — недвижимость! подробнее

Category Категории: Инвестирование     Tags Теги:

Тренировка дома или спортзал? Подсчитаем.

Author Автор: Роман Чернышов    Опубликовано: 13 октября 2023

Сегодня мы поговорим про спорт, а в частности про занятия в спортзале(фитнес). Вообще спортзал это не совсем спорт, это тренировка, в чем разница тренировки от спорта? Физическая тренировка это лишь один из этапов в достижении цели, в спорте. Спорт же подразумевает подготовку и физическую, и психологическую, и моральную, и четко поставленные цели, и тактику, и стратегию, и конечно результаты, которые измеримы(не только размером мышц). Но самое главное, спорт это всегда соперничество, за номер один. А что такое походы в спортзал «бицуню покачать»? Ответ на этот вопрос оставлю вам. И так, перейдём к подсчетам. подробнее

Генератор текста-рыбы (Lorem Ipsum, бредо-генератор, генератор речи)

Author Автор: Роман Чернышов    Опубликовано: 12 октября 2023

Текст-рыба Доброго времени друзья! При разработке сайта(отрисовки макета, верстки или наполнения БД) — первичной подготовке шаблона, очень часто для наглядности необходимо заполнить его текстовым контентом, но текст нужно где-то взять, а копирование с произвольных сайтов решение «так себе». Гораздо лучше воспользоваться онлайн генератором текста-рыбы, который позволит путем задания его параметров, быстро создать уникальный текст, в любом количестве, в виде: слов, предложений, абзацев и списков. Несмотря на кажущуюся простоту инструмента, он зачастую позволяет сэкономить уйму времени. подробнее

Проверка IP в спам базах

Author Автор: Роман Чернышов    Опубликовано: 11 октября 2023

spam Доброго времени друзья! Одним из распространенных вопросов, с которым обращаются ко мне владельцы сайта, это — почему E-Mail, отправленный с их сайта не доходит до пользователя или маркируются почтовыми службами как СПАМ. Причин может быть множество, и одна их них это попадание IP сервера где расположен сайт и с которого осуществляется E-Mail рассылка в черный список (антисмап-база, Black Lists, DNSBL). Для того, чтобы проверить наличие вашего IP в таких черных списках, нужно сформировать и отправить на их сервера(которых насчитывается несколько десятков) специальный запрос, с указанием вашего IP. Для автоматизации этого процесса, я разработал этот скрипт, где вы можете разом осуществить такую проверку, просто укажите IP и нажмите кнопку «Проверить». подробнее

Сериализованный код в читаемый (Unserialize)

Author Автор: Роман Чернышов    Опубликовано: 10 октября 2023

При разработке программного обеспечения часто приходиться иметь дело с данными которые представлены в сериализованном виде, что это такое? Это данные представляющие собой текстовую строку, имеющую специальную структуру, благодаря чему представить в таком(текстовом) виде можно: массив или объект. Данные в таком виде удобно передавать по сети или хранить в базе данных, но их крайне сложно воспринимать человеку «на глаз». Для наглядного представления сериализованных данных, нужно провести процедуру десериализации(Unserialize) и отобразить их затем в понятной человеку форме. подробнее

Генератор макетов веб-страниц (HTML/CSS/JS)

Author Автор: Роман Чернышов    Опубликовано: 10 октября 2023

Доброго времени друзья! Мне часто приходится верстать HTML/CSS-шаблоны сайтов из представленных PSD макетов дизайна, адаптивные, в несколько колонок, с разным расположением сайтбара(закреплённая боковая панель) и разной компоновкой по части подключаемых библиотек. Для упрощения задачи, я разработал генератор макетов веб-страниц онлайн, которым сам и пользуюсь. Просто задайте необходимые параметры: ширину макета, резиновый или фиксированный, количество колонок, расположение сайтбаров, добавьте блоки меню в нужные места страницы, задайте дополнительные опции, библиотеки(подгружаемые из CDN), кодировку и версию HTML документа, затем нажмите «Сгенерировать» и получите готовый HTML/CSS код для последующей работы. Генератор HTML-макетов отлично подойдет не только начинающему веб-разработчику, но и разработчику с опытом, он поможет сократить время на написание основы ваших будущих веб-страниц. подробнее

Форматирование HTML кода

Author Автор: Роман Чернышов    Опубликовано: 8 октября 2023

html beautiful Доброго времени друзья! Мне как веб-разработчику ежедневно приходится работать с большим объемом HTML кода, от простых правок в готовом проекте, до написания кода верстки веб-страницы с нуля. Где форматирование и чистота кода зачастую играет не последнюю роль. Хорошо, если вы работаете с кодом в профессиональном редакторе(IDE) который сам умеет форматировать код, но что если в качестве редактора выступает простой «Блокнот» или «Файловый менеджер» (я например работаю в Far Manager)? В этом случае для форматирования HTML кода будет полезен данный онлайн инструмент, просто вставьте код, укажите параметры и получите результат. подробнее

Форматирование JSON

Author Автор: Роман Чернышов    Опубликовано: 8 октября 2023

JSON (JavaScript Object Notation) — специальный текстовый формат для обмена данными, из названия понятно где и для чего он был изначально разработан(JavaScript), сейчас же его можно встретить повсеместно, он проник во все языки программирования, стал основой для обмена данными не только между пользователем и сервером(AJAX, REST-API), но и во множестве бекенд-сервисов(PostgreSQL, JSONB). При этом формат очень прост, его синтаксис представляет собой {«ключ»: «значение»}, что легко понимается и читается людьми(в сравнении с XML например). Таким образом можно передавать: строки, числа, литералы, массивы, объекты. Для наглядного представления JSON данных, достаточно их только отформатировать, разбив код на строки и расставив в нужном месте табуляцию, и для этого вам поможет скрипт онлайн форматирования JSON.
подробнее

Category Категории: Инструменты     Tags Теги:

Генератор хеша (хеш суммы)

Author Автор: Роман Чернышов    Опубликовано: 7 октября 2023

Криптографическая хеш-функция — это алгоритм который преобразует полученный текст в уникальную кеш-сумму, строку(которую еще называют «Контрольная сумма»), состоящую из нескольких символов(10, 16, 32 и т.д.), полученная хеш-сумма может использоваться для подписи данных или файлов(при изменении хотябы одного байта, хеш-сумма полностью изменится), хранения пароля в базе данных и т.д. Полученный хеш, как правило необратим, т.е. зная его нельзя установить изначальные данные из которых он был сгенерирован. Например, если злоумышленник получит доступ к базе данных, и получит хеши паролей пользователей, то он не сможет ими воспользоваться и узнать истинные пароли(чем длиннее хеш, тем сложнее подобрать его методом перебора). Для генерации хеша, воспользуйтесь формой ниже, укажите текст и предпочитаемый алгоритм хеширования. подробнее

Автор блога
Роман Чернышов
Веб-разработчик,
Full Stack
Senior, Architect
PHP, JavaScript, Node.JS, Python, HTML 5, CSS 3, MySQL, Bash, Linux Admin
Заказать работу
предложить оффер

Моя книга
Книга. Веб-разработчик. Легкий вход в профессию
Печатная книга
Веб-разработчик.
Легкий вход в профессию
Купить за 359₽
Популярные записи
Последние вопросы
Список вопросов
Последние комментарии
Меню

Archive

Мои проекты
Insurance CMS Love Crm CMS Совместные покупки Мой PHP Framework Хостинг для моих клиентов Лицензии на мой софт и поддержка